ML228
Synonym(s): CID-46742353
- CAS No.: 1357171-62-0
- Formula:C27H21N5
- Molecular Weight:415.49
IUPAC Name: N-([1,1'-biphenyl]-4-ylmethyl)-6-phenyl-3-(pyridin-2-yl)-1,2,4-triazin-5-amine
InChIKey: QNRODODTMXCRKU-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ES: C1(C2=NC=CC=C2)=NC(NCC3=CC=C(C4=CC=CC=C4)C=C3)=C(C5=CC=CC=C5)N=N1
Biological Activity: ML228 (CID-46742353) is a potent the Hypoxia Inducible Factor (HIF) pathway activator with EC50 of 1 μM. ML228 potently activates HIF in vitro as well as its downstream target VEGF[1][2].
